The Courant American Newspaper
Cartersville, Georgia
March 23, 1893. Page 8

Brice Randolph has returned from the Indian Territory after having resided there six weeks. Brice couldn’t be warded off from Georgia any longer. Says he is willing to live and die in Bartow county.

Messrs. Thomas Wofford and Bob White who went when Brice did are well pleased and getting along O. K. They are located in the Cherokee nation, about twenty miles from Fort Smith, Ark. Their many friends rejoice to know of their prosperity.
